Community Development Manager: In this role, professionals work closely with indigenous communities to foster positive growth and development. They address social, economic, and environmental challenges while ensuring cultural sensitivity and inclusivity. 2. Indigenous Policy Analyst: Policy analysts in this field research, analyze, and recommend policies concerning indigenous affairs, promoting equitable outcomes for indigenous communities. They collaborate with governmental bodies and community stakeholders to ensure that policies accurately reflect and address indigenous issues. 3. Indigenous Outreach Coordinator: Outreach coordinators serve as the bridge between indigenous communities and external organizations, ensuring effective communication and collaboration. They plan and implement programs that foster understanding and respect for indigenous cultures and traditions. 4. Cultural Liaison Officer: Cultural liaison officers work with educational institutions, government agencies, and other organizations to promote cultural awareness and inclusivity. They facilitate cross-cultural communication, advocate for indigenous perspectives, and assist in the development of culturally appropriate policies and practices. 5. Traditional Knowledge Keeper: Traditional knowledge keepers play a significant role in preserving and sharing indigenous knowledge, customs, and languages. They collaborate with communities, researchers, and educators to ensure that traditional knowledge is respected, valued, and integrated into contemporary contexts, ensuring its preservation for future generations.
